FlexCost reveals true cost of demand-side resources
Energy Consumers Australia (ECA) and Australia’s national science agency, CSIRO, have published the FlexCost methodology, a new economic analysis framework that will estimate how demand-side energy resources can contribute to a lower cost electricity system.
